They take a sample of blood from a vein in your arm and send the sample to a laboratory ... and TSH levels, can be corrected … WebFeb 16, 2024 · It measures how much of the thyroid hormone thyroxine (T4) the thyroid gland is being asked to make. An abnormally high TSH means hypothyroidism: the thyroid gland is being asked to make more T4 because there isn’t enough T4 in the blood. T4 tests. Most of the T4 in the blood is attached to a protein called thyroxine-binding globulin. easy chicken wild rice casserole

DiscombobulatedBus81 • 8 min. ago. if your concerned about a thyroid disease and/or a autoimmune disorder...this is hardly even a test. you should be getting a … WebThis is especially true if we have made a recent medication change. If a patient skips their medication the morning of the blood test, it is harder to determine dosing adjustments. The longer someone has been on thyroid medication, the more likely we are to have them skip taking the medication the morning of a blood test. PYHP 092 Full Transcript:

WebJan 30, 2024 · A normal range for TSH in most laboratories is 0.4 milliunits per liter (mU/L) to 4.0 mU/L. If your TSH is higher than 4.0 mU/L on repeat tests, you probably have hypothyroidism.
